Description

The TPS552882-Q1 is a synchronous four-switch buck-boost converter capable of regulating the output voltage at, above, or below the input voltage. The TPS552882-Q1 operates over 2.7-V to 36-V wide input voltage and is capable of outputing 0.8-V to 22-V voltage to support a variety of applications.
The TPS552882-Q1 integrates two 16-A MOSFETs of the boost leg to balance the solution size and efficiency. The TPS552882-Q1 uses external resistor divider to set the output voltage with 1.2-V intenral reference voltage. The TPS552882-Q1 is capable of delivering 100 W from 12-V input voltage.
The TPS552882-Q1 employs an average current-mode control scheme. The switching frequency is programmable from 200 kHz to 2.2 MHz by an external resistor and can be synchronized to an external clock. The TPS552882-Q1 also provides optional spread spectrum to minimize peak EMI.
The TPS552882-Q1 offers output overvoltage protection, average inductor current limit, cycle-by-cycle peak current limit, and output short circuit protection. The TPS552882-Q1 also ensures safe operating with optional output current limit and hiccup-mode protection in sustained overload conditions.
The TPS552882-Q1 can use a small inductor and small capacitors with high switching frequency. It is available in a 4.0-mm × 3.5-mm QFN package.
